The procession on both sides of the external north and south walls flanking the entrance forms a single line seen from opposite sides, as the participants move towards the steps at the front of the altar. The figures are lifesize and appear to be the individual likenesses of the participants. Augustus is shown as Pontifex Maximus among the group at the front of the line. Further down stands M. Vipsanius Agrippa clutching a scroll in his right hand. His head is covered respectfully with his toga, perhaps recognising the fact of his death, which occurred during the carving of the frieze. Behind him is Livia Drusilla and her hand rests upon the head of a young girl.15 Following her is the figure of Tiberius looking serious and wearing a toga and ankle-length closed boots of a high status Roman. Behind him, a woman pauses to listen to a man who is talking to her (plate 31). He is slightly taller than the woman. The man is seen in profile and is not dressed like the other men in the procession. He wears the paludamentum, the military cloak over his left shoulder, and caligae, the sturdy boots worn by soldiers upon his feet. This is surely Nero Claudius Drusus, the commander of the Rhine army? Drusus appears to be speaking, while a boy clutches the edge of his cloak and chats with another older boy by his side. As he talks Antonia listens while holding the hand of a very young, well-behaved boy – presumably her oldest son, Nero – who wears child size national Roman costume.16 It is a surprisingly intimate moment for such a public monument, a snapshot in a virtual photo album of members of the imperial family in peaceful celebration of a religious rite on the First Lady’s birthday, preserved for the ages in marble.
